I just got my new/used 2002 ws6 trans am and i love it. It has a few bolt on mods to it like slp cold air box, exhaust, wheels, springs. So the first weekend with the car was awsome but the second weekend brought some rain which was not welcomed but normally excepted while on the way to work in medium to heavy rain my car starts to freak out like if the plugs got wet or like if my intake sucked up water i pulled over and after about 3-4 min my check engine like went away and my car drove fine. Since then my car has been ok but if i wet the car and i mean like the windshield and decide to drive it will run like if it is in the water for a few min

It sounds like you may have a problem with an electrical short. I had a mazda that acted like that until I took off the plug wires and coated the plugs with dielectric grease. If it happens at night, raise your hood and see if you can see any electric shorts. Check for any poor conections or bare wires.
